The popularity of crypto-mining in Iran due to low electricity costs has been evident. In the latest news, Iran’s Ministry of Industries, Mining and Trade recently issued 1000+ licenses for cryptocurrency mining units, according to a report.

A limited number of authorized mining farms were active across the country.

Amir Hossein Saeedi Naeini, an official with Iran’s ICT Guild Organization, in an interview with IBENA news, said that many Iranians were attracted to the crypto mining industry.

He stated,

“Our studies show that the crypto mining industry has the potential to add $8.5 billion to the economy.”

Expanding on the same, he suggested that modifying the electricity rates could help boost the crypto mining industry and also generate more revenue.
